Christmas Cheer
with Highly Strung and friends

Come and join Highly Strung and friends for coffee,mulled-wine, mince pies and plenty of Christmas cheer  while supporting

Thursday 21st November 6.00pm to 9.30pm
Friday 22nd November 10.00am to 12.30pm

at
Church Farm House, Coombe Bissett, SP5 4LR

All proceeds will buy essential medicines for the CRESS funded clinic.
